Summary:

"Raised in a changing Pakistan by an enlightened father from a poor background and a beautiful, illiterate mother, Malala was taught to stand up for what she believes. Her story of bravery and determination in the face of extremism is more timely than ever"-- Provided by publisher.

General Note:
Issued as a Wonderbook, a pre-loaded audiobook player permanently attached to a hardcover book.
Powered by a rechargeable battery ; Charge with a micro USB cord.
Audiobook player has 2 modes. Read-along mode narrates the story. Learning mode asks questions related to the story.
Not for children under 3 years.
Adult supervision recommended.
"Adapted from I am Malala (Young Readers Edition), published in hardcover in August 2014 by Little, Brown and Company"--Title page verso.
